Scope and Content Note

The George V. Jordan Papers cover the years 1847 to 1880, and document the numerous voyages made by this shipmaster out of Saco, Maine, and Boson, to the Virgin Islands, Barbados, Havana, Calcutta, Australia, France, Liverpool, Antwerp, Philadelphia, Charleston, New Orleans, and San Francisco. The collection has been divided into two series.

Series I. Ships' Papers contains the papers of individual ships, the schooners Charles Cooper, Martha A. Nott, and Wallace. These papers are dated from 1847 to 1872.

Series II. Correspondence and Accounts contains miscellaneous business and personal correspondence and accounts.

Biographical Sketch

George Vaughn Jordan was born August 1845 in Maine. Jordan was a ship master who sailed out of Saco, Maine, and Boston and went to the Virgin Islands, Barbados, Havana, Calcutta, Australia, France, Liverpool, Antwerp, Philadelphia, Charleston, New Orleans, and San Francisco. He married Jeanette, born October 1845, in New York. They had one daughter, Nettie, who was born June 1879 in Iowa. According to the 1900 Federal Census, George became a farmer, raising livestock in Iowa.

Provenance

This material is a reorganization and integration of two folders, one box from the Phillips Family Papers, and several folders removed from the Andrew and William Heath Papers. All items added to the collection have their original location marked on the back of them or on the folder.
